Strong's H4071 (Hebrew)

Hebrew: מְדוּרָה (mᵉdûwrâh)

Pronunciation: med-oo-raw'

Morphology: n-f

Derivation: or מְדֻרָה (mᵉdurâh); from דּוּר (dûwr) H1752 in the sense of accumulation

Definition: a pile of fuel

KJV Renderings: pile (for fire)

Senses

  1. pile (of fuel), pyre, pile (of wood)
